ENVIRONMENT AND SUSTAINABILITY

We are committed to reducing our environmental impact and continually improving our environmental performance as an integral part of our business strategy and operating methods, with regular review points. We will encourage customers, suppliers and other stakeholders to do the same.

Some of our initiatives:

  • Ensure our suppliers align with our sustainability requirements when onboarding – ensuring the advertising landscape is evolving

  • Achieve carbon negativity ahead of target (2025)

  • Eliminate single use plastics completely from our offices and activities

  • LED efficient lighting to be maintained throughout our estate

  • Smart plugs and motion detectors will be used to reduce unnecessary heating/lighting

  • We will promote the use of travel alternatives such as e-mail or video/phone conferencing

  • We can supply our full environmental, sustainability and carbon policies requests.

OUR MENTAL HEALTH AMBASSADORS

Our mental health first aider’s role is to act as a first point of contact for people with mental health issues, providing a confidential and safe space to listen and sign-post. As well as being someone to talk to whenever they are struggling, a mental health first aider also acts as an advocate for mental health in the workplace, helping to reduce stigmas and enact positive change.

OUR CHARITY

East Yorkshire Foodbank opened in May 2016 to give people in crisis hope, practical help, and a brighter future. The Foodbank is a project funded by local churches and community groups, working together towards stopping hunger in our local area.

They provide three days’ nutritionally balanced emergency food and support to local people who are referred from a crisis. They are part of a nationwide network of food banks, supported by The Trussell Trust, working to combat poverty and hunger across the UK.
